Introduction

The tags beginning with mail.cisco identify events generated by Cisco Email Security Appliance.

Valid tags and data tables 

The full tag must have 4 levels. The first two are fixed as mail.cisco. The third level identifies the type of events sent. The fourth level indicates the event subtype.

These are the valid tags and corresponding data tables that will receive the parsers' data:
